Code B1698 2014 Toyota RAV4 Description

The B1698 diagnostic trouble code (DTC) for a 2014 Toyota RAV4 indicates that there is an issue with the Door Side Airbag Sensor Left Initialization being incomplete. This sensor is responsible for detecting impacts or collisions on the left side of the vehicle and deploying the side airbag to protect occupants in the event of a crash. When the initialization process is incomplete, it means that the sensor may not be functioning properly, which could potentially lead to the airbag not deploying when needed.

Common Causes of B1698 2014 Toyota RAV4

  1. Wiring harness issues
  2. Faulty door side airbag sensor
  3. Malfunctioning airbag control module
  4. Corrosion or damage to sensor connectors
  5. Impact or collision that affected the sensor's functionality

Symptoms of B1698 2014 Toyota RAV4

  1. Airbag warning light illuminated on the dashboard
  2. Inability to turn off the airbag warning light
  3. Side airbag system not functioning properly
  4. Diagnostic trouble code B1698 stored in the vehicle's computer system

How to Fix B1698 2014 Toyota RAV4

  1. Begin by connecting a diagnostic scanner to the vehicle's OBD-II port to retrieve the specific trouble code and confirm the issue.
  2. Inspect the wiring harness connected to the door side airbag sensor for any damage, corrosion, or loose connections. Repair or replace any damaged wiring as needed.
  3. Test the door side airbag sensor for proper functionality using a multimeter or specialized diagnostic tool. Replace the sensor if it is found to be faulty.
  4. Check the airbag control module for any faults or errors that may be causing the initialization issue. Reset or replace the control module if necessary.
  5. Clear the trouble code from the vehicle's computer system and perform a test drive to ensure that the issue has been resolved and the airbag system is functioning correctly.

Cost to Fix B1698 2014 Toyota RAV4

The typical repair costs for addressing a Door Side Airbag Sensor Left Initialization Incomplete issue can vary depending on the specific cause of the problem and the extent of the repairs needed. In general, the cost of parts for a new door side airbag sensor can range from $200 to $500, while the cost of labor for diagnosis and repair can range from $100 to $300. Overall, the total repair cost for this issue could range from $300 to $800, but it is advisable to consult with a professional mechanic or auto repair shop for a more accurate estimate based on the specific circumstances of the vehicle. Precautions for SRS “AIR BAG” and “SEAT BELT PRE-TENSIONER” Service

  • Never probe the electrical connectors on air bag, side air curtain modules or seat belts.
  • Never disassemble or tamper with safety belt buckle/retractor pretensioners, adaptive load limiting retractors, safety belt inflators, or probe the electrical connectors.
  • Do not use electrical test equipment to check SRS circuits unless instructed to in this Service Manual.
  • Before servicing the SRS, turn ignition switch OFF, disconnect both battery cables and wait at least 3 minutes. For approximately 3 minutes after the cables are removed, it is still possible for the air bag and seat belt pre-tensioner to deploy. Therefore, do not work on any SRS connectors or wires until at least 3 minutes have passed.

Failure to follow this instruction may result in the accidental deployment of these modules, which increases the risk of serious personal injury or death.

Frequently Asked Questions about B1698 2014 Toyota RAV4 Code

What does the OBDII code B1698 mean for a 2014 Toyota RAV4?

The code B1698 indicates that the door side airbag sensor on the left side has not completed its initialization process, which can affect the airbag system's functionality.

What symptoms might I experience if my RAV4 has the B1698 code?

You may notice the airbag warning light illuminated on the dashboard, and the airbag system may be disabled, meaning it won’t deploy in the event of an accident.

What could cause the B1698 code to trigger?

Common causes include a malfunctioning left door side airbag sensor, poor electrical connections, damaged wiring, or issues with the airbag control module.

Can I reset the B1698 code myself?

While you can attempt to reset the code using an OBDII scanner, it’s important to ensure the underlying issue is resolved first; otherwise, the code may return.

What steps should I take if I encounter the B1698 code?

First, inspect the left door side airbag sensor and its wiring for any damage or loose connections. If everything appears fine, you may need to consult a professional for further diagnosis.

Is it safe to drive my RAV4 with the B1698 code present?

It is not recommended to drive the vehicle with this code present, as the airbag system may not function properly in a crash.

How can I determine if the airbag sensor is faulty?

You can perform a continuity test on the sensor’s wiring and connections or use a diagnostic tool to check for any additional codes that may indicate sensor failure.

Will clearing the B1698 code fix the problem?

Clearing the code will not fix the problem; it only removes the error from the system. You need to address the root cause to prevent the code from reappearing.

What is the cost of repairing the issue related to the B1698 code?

Repair costs can vary widely depending on the cause, but replacing the airbag sensor or fixing wiring issues could range from $100 to $500 or more, depending on labor and part costs.

Should I take my RAV4 to a dealership for B1698 code issues?

While you can take your vehicle to a dealership, many independent mechanics with experience in airbag systems can also diagnose and repair the issue effectively.
